A cast iron scone pan is designed specifically for baking scones, a beloved treat in British cuisine, characterized by its fluffy texture and crumbly exterior. The advantages of using cast iron for baking are manifold excellent heat retention, even cooking, and the natural non-stick properties that develop over time. These characteristics make cast iron an ideal choice for baking scones, as it allows for a golden crust while keeping the insides soft and moist.

When searching for a cast iron scone pan, it’s important for shoppers to consider a few key factors. First, look for pans that are made in locations known for their quality craftsmanship, such as the United States or Europe. Second, check for user reviews regarding heat distribution and ease of cleaning. A high-quality scone pan should be easy to maintain with a simple wash and occasional seasoning.
